Bacteriostatic water is contraindicated, or forbidden, from being used in neonates, newborns in the first 28 days of their life. Another key difference is availability. Bacteriostatic water is very easy to manufacture while sterile water is an arduous process. There have been times when sterile water has been in short supply.

Bacteriostatic Water (bacteriostatic water for injection) is sterile water containing 0. 9% benzyl alcohol that is used to dilute or dissolve medications; the container can be reentered multiple times (usually by a sterile needle) and the benzyl alcohol suppresses or stops the growth of most potentially contaminating bacteria.

Bacteriostatic Water for Injection, USP is a sterile, nonpyrogenic preparation of water for injection containing 0. 9% (9 mg/mL) or 1. 1% (11 mg/mL) benzyl alcohol added as a bacteriostatic preservative. It is supplied in a multiple-dose container from which repeated withdrawals may be made to dilute or dissolve drugs for injection.
